The Life and Acts of St. Patrick

Jocelin's 'The Life and Acts of St. Patrick' presents a richly detailed narrative that blends hagiography with historical anecdotes, offering readers a compelling account of Ireland's patron saint. Written in the late 12th century, this text reflects the spiritual fervor of the period, intertwining folklore and documented accounts to create a vibrant tableau of St. Patrick's life. Jocelin's literary style is marked by eloquent prose and rhetorical flourishes, evoking the moral and religious aspirations of a Christian audience, while simultaneously participating in the broader medieval literary context of saintly biographies that sought to inspire and edify. As an Irish cleric, Jocelin was deeply influenced by the cultural and religious milieu of his time. His ecclesiastical background and likely close ties to monastic communities equipped him with both the theological insight and historical context necessary to articulate the life of St. Patrick. The nuances of his writing reflect a profound reverence for the saint and an understanding of the socio-political landscape of Ireland at the time which shaped the hagiography effectively. Readers interested in the intersection of history and spirituality will find 'The Life and Acts of St. Patrick' an essential text. This work not only chronicles the legendary feats of St. Patrick but also serves as a vital cultural artifact that conveys the enduring legacy of faith in Irish identity. Engaging with this text offers invaluable insights into the historical and spiritual heritage of Ireland, making it a must-read for scholars and enthusiasts alike.
